I’m not sure you can say if we’d have done this since Christmas we’d be ok. You need to be more adaptable against certain teams and Spurs are perfect for that system yesterday as they are very quick in transition and dangerous on the break. We stifled them with the extra defender but I’m not sure it would work as well against other teams. Also, the personnel available almost enforced the system. That said, I doubt that Dyche would have played that system with the available personnel, certainly not Lowton on the left of a 3. Kudos to the manager for going with it as we were very solid at the back.

Dwight had a great game as did Cork who was magnificent yesterday.
